Você está aqui: VBA ::: Dicas & Truques ::: Matemática e Estatística |
Como testar se uma string é um valor numérico válido em VBA usando a função IsNumeric()Quantidade de visualizações: 500 vezes |
Em várias situações nós precisamos ler valores a partir de arquivos texto ou informados pelo usuário. Antes de efetuarmos qualquer cálculo, é necessário verificar se as informações lidas são valores numéricos válidos. Para tais situações nós podemos usar a função IsNumeric() do VBA. Esta função aceita uma expressão e retorna True se a expressão for um valor numérico válido e False em caso contrário. Veja o código VBA completo demonstrando o uso da função IsNumeric(): ---------------------------------------------------------------------- Se precisar de ajuda com o código abaixo, pode me chamar no WhatsApp +55 (62) 98553-6711 (Osmar) ---------------------------------------------------------------------- ' Macro que permite verificar se um valor é do tipo numérico Sub TestarValorNumerico() ' vamos declarar uma variável do tipo String Dim valor As String ' a string vai representar um valor numérico valor = "562.12" ' agora vamos testar se a variável possui um valor númerico válido If IsNumeric(valor) Then MsgBox "O valor é numérico." Else MsgBox "O valor não é numérico." End If End Sub Ao executar este código VBA nós teremos o seguinte resultado: O valor é numérico. |
![]() |
Veja mais Dicas e truques de VBA |
Dicas e truques de outras linguagens |
Python - Como usar a biblioteca Pandas do Python em seus projetos de Data Science e Machine Learning |
E-Books em PDF |
||||
|
||||
|
||||
Linguagens Mais Populares |
||||
1º lugar: Java |